What I Look For in a Handheld Vacuum for Stairs
For stairs, I focus on a few important features. I want strong suction, a comfortable grip, a lightweight design, and a battery that lasts long enough to finish the job. I also pay attention to whether the vacuum comes with useful attachments like a crevice tool or brush tool, since those make it much easier to clean stair edges and carpet fibers.
Suction Power
In my experience, suction power is one of the most important things to check. If the vacuum cannot pull dirt from carpeted stairs or remove pet hair properly, it will not save me time. I usually look for a model that performs well on both hard surfaces and carpeted steps.
Weight and Portability
Since I have to carry the vacuum up and down stairs, I prefer a model that feels light in my hand. A heavy vacuum can become tiring quickly, especially if I need to clean multiple flights. A compact design also helps me store it easily when I am done.
Battery Life and Charging
If I choose a cordless model, I always check the battery life. I want enough runtime to clean my stairs without stopping halfway through to recharge. Fast charging is also helpful because it means the vacuum is ready when I need it again.
Attachments and Accessories
I find attachments very useful for stair cleaning. A crevice tool helps me reach corners and edges, while a brush attachment works well on fabric and carpet. If I deal with pet hair often, I like a motorized brush attachment because it can make cleaning much easier.
Dust Bin Capacity and Emptying
I prefer a dust bin that is easy to empty without making a mess. Since stairs can collect a surprising amount of dust and debris, I want a bin that does not fill up too quickly. A washable filter is also a plus because it helps me maintain the vacuum more easily.
Corded vs Cordless
When I shop for a stair vacuum, I consider whether I want corded or cordless. Cordless models give me more freedom and are easier to move around, which I usually like for stairs. Corded models may offer more consistent power, but I find them less convenient when I need to move quickly between steps.
Noise Level
I also pay attention to how loud the vacuum is. A quieter model makes the cleaning process more pleasant, especially if I clean while others are at home. While noise is not my top priority, I do appreciate a vacuum that does not sound overly harsh.
Maintenance and Durability
I want a vacuum that is easy to maintain and built to last. Cleaning the filter, emptying the dust bin, and checking for blockages should not feel like a chore. A durable model gives me more confidence that it will handle regular stair cleaning over time.
